Luxurious Accommodations

Indulge in the elegant charm of the John Rutledge House Inn, where each guest room is thoughtfully appointed with modern amenities such as a flat-screen TV, DVD player, and complimentary Wi-Fi. Relax in style with plush robes and a cozy sitting area, creating a true home away from home experience.

Exceptional Dining and Service

Start your day with a delicious continental breakfast served in a picturesque setting of your choice - be it the guest room, the ballroom, or the tranquil courtyard. Unwind in the evenings with complimentary drinks and take advantage of the 24-hour concierge service for a truly personalized stay.

"Only a picky person would take issue with this Inn"

10.0

We took a room in the main house for 3 nights. It was an amazing stay with amazing staff. The front desk staff were particularly helpful - upon arrival I erroneously parked in the church car park next door - an easy mistake but no harm. I was directed to the Inns’ car park to the rear. A very easy self-park - particularly to unload the luggage😃 Our king-bed room in the main house (lower floor) was pretty large - complete with couches and dining table with chairs - it would be referred to as a suite in a modern hotel. It was well serviced - kept clean - fresh towels etc. Coffee making facilities are external to the room. Breakfast was cooked to order - served in the garden - and very wholesome. The afternoon tea and snacks; plus the evening port/sherry/brandy made slipping in/out very easy whilst walking between Charleston attractions. Overall it is not “at the cheap end of hotels - but very good value” - easy to return and recommend.

"Great stay and location"

10.0

We stayed in the Carriage House out back. Our room was great and the staff wonderful. You fill out a door hanger the night before what you want for breakfast, when, and where. We ate breakfast in the Courtyard two mornings and the ballroom in the main house the third (little cooler that morning). A lot of little nice touches like cold bottled water in a cooler outside so you could grab a water before you explore. Longest walk to dinner was probably about 7 minutes.
